Meta, the parent company of Facebook and Instagram, has announced a significant restructuring effort, cutting 10% of its workforce. This move is part of the company's push to invest more in artificial intelligence (AI). According to CNBC Tech, about 8,000 employees will be laid off. This decision is expected to have a significant impact on the development and maintenance of Meta's AI tools, including its chatbots and content moderation systems.
The layoffs are also expected to affect the company's AI research initiatives, which have been a key focus area for Meta in recent years. As reported by CNBC Tech, Meta has been tracking employee keystrokes and mouse clicks on popular sites like Google, LinkedIn, and Wikipedia as part of an AI training initiative. This data collection effort is likely to be impacted by the layoffs, which could slow down the development of Meta's AI tools.
The impact of these layoffs on the competitive landscape of AI tools is also significant. With Meta reducing its workforce, other companies like Google and Microsoft may see an opportunity to poach talented AI researchers and engineers. This could lead to a shift in the balance of power in the AI tools market, with companies that are able to attract and retain top talent gaining a competitive advantage.
